一、获取SSL证书
安装SSL证书前需完成以下操作:
- 通过证书机构(如Let’s Encrypt、DigiCert)申请证书,获取包含
.crt
和.key
文件的压缩包 - 根据服务器类型选择证书格式(Apache/Nginx),下载对应的证书文件
- 验证域名所有权,通常通过DNS解析或文件验证完成
二、上传证书文件
通过以下两种方式传输文件:
- 使用FTP客户端将证书上传至
web
根目录 - 通过虚拟主机控制面板的文件管理器直接上传
需确保同时上传证书文件(.crt/.pem
)和私钥文件(.key
)
三、配置虚拟主机
登录主机控制面板后按步骤操作:
- 在「域名管理」中找到SSL配置入口
- 将证书内容粘贴至PEM编码区域,包括:
- 证书链内容(服务器证书+中间证书)
- 私钥文件完整内容
- 保存配置后重启Web服务(Apache/Nginx)
四、启用HTTPS跳转
强制HTTP流量跳转HTTPS:
- 通过控制面板开启「强制HTTPS」开关
- 在
.htaccess
添加重定向规则:
RewriteEngine On
RewriteCond %{HTTPS} off
R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
五、测试与维护
完成安装后需进行验证:
- 访问
https://域名
检查浏览器锁标志 - 使用SSL Labs等工具检测证书链完整性
- 设置证书到期前30天的自动提醒
通过控制面板可视化配置与文件上传相结合的方式,可在10分钟内完成SSL证书部署。建议优先选用与主机商兼容的证书类型,并定期检查证书有效性状态
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/624475.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。